Comco Ikarus GmbH is a German aircraft manufacturer. The company produced hang gliders through the late 1970s, followed by ultralight aircraft, FRS brand ballistic parachutes and light aircraft.[1][2]
Aircraft
Model name | First flight | Number built | Type |
---|---|---|---|
Ikarus 500 | 1976 | 2000 | Hang glider |
Ikarus Sherpa | 1982 | Ultralight aircraft | |
Ikarus C22 | 1987 | Ultralight aircraft | |
Ikarus C42 | 1996 | 1200+ | Light aircraft |
Ikarus C52 | 2011 | Light aircraft | |
